Here are just some of the life-changing programs that our monthly givers make possible:

student2student
Our student2student program works by matching students who need to improve their literacy skills with trained reading buddies to build their confidence.

Learning Clubs
Our out-of-school Learning Clubs provide a supportive environment for students to catch up, improve their skills and get tailored learning support from caring volunteer tutors.

Passport Program
Children in Year 6 are empowered to learn crucial, practical skills to help them transition to high school successfully and be prepared for the next stage of their school journey.
